Definitions:

Generalist Species

Organisms that can thrive in a wide variety of environmental conditions and can make use of a variety of different resources.

Broad Niche

An ecological concept referring to the ability of a species to tolerate a wide range of environmental conditions and use varied resources, allowing it to live in many different habitats.

Specialist Species

Organisms that can thrive only in a narrow range of environmental conditions or have a limited diet due to specialized needs.

Biopharming

The process of using genetically modified plants or animals to produce pharmaceuticals and other substances such as antibodies or vaccines.
